首页 > Windows开发 > 详细

C# 多态virtual标记重写

时间:2020-07-21 11:53:48      阅读:84      评论:0      收藏:0      [点我收藏+]

首先你如果不用baivirtual重写的话,系统默认会为du你加new关键字,他zhi的作用是覆盖,而virtual的关键作用在dao于实现多态

virtual 代表在继承了这个类的子类里面可以使用override将此方法重载

virtual:标记方法为虚方法
1.可在派生类中以override覆盖此方法
2.不覆盖也可由对象调用
3.无此标记的方法(也无其他标记),重写时需用new隐藏原方法
abstract 与virtual : 方法重写时都使用 override 关键字

 

对于使用AsNoTracking()的数据不能用于修改。

技术分享图片

 

 不能这样修改

技术分享图片

 

 技术分享图片

 

C# 多态virtual标记重写

原文:https://www.cnblogs.com/netlock/p/13353019.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!